What is the median home price in Rio del Mar?

The median home value in Rio del Mar is $1.3M. The median monthly rent is $3,387. Annual property taxes average $8k. Home values are based on U.S. Census Bureau American Community Survey estimates.

Are home values rising in Rio del Mar?

Home values in Rio del Mar have increased 24.1% over the past two years. This indicates a strong appreciation trend. This data is sourced from the Federal Housing Finance Agency (FHFA) House Price Index.

How much income do you need to buy a home in Rio del Mar?

Based on a typical all-in ownership cost of $3,227/month (mortgage, taxes, insurance), you'd generally need a household income of approximately $138k/year to keep housing costs at or below 28% of gross income — a common lender guideline. The median household income in Rio del Mar is $164k/year.
